Output 43184f2a6101e3a85a8e86f8d2e355ec2eecbd3d4ff1c8efc4ebfa7dfd8161b4:1

value
345889073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4151b25534c991d0e6250503c3e2bd97a18c1322 OP_EQUAL
address
37ePiPjwSaBskV8PEpZmA5buLUVkR3oYAY
transaction
43184f2a6101e3a85a8e86f8d2e355ec2eecbd3d4ff1c8efc4ebfa7dfd8161b4
confirmations
301013
spent
true